Sulky Metallic Thread 250yd-Opalescent is a premium aluminum-infused polyester thread designed for embroidery, topstitching, and handwork. Optimized for use with 80/85 14 needles and vertical spool pins, it offers a brilliant reflective finish in a wide range of colors. Each spool contains 250 yards of durable, machine-washable thread, perfect for adding a professional sparkle to your creative projects.

Easy to Blend
I mainly use this thread to blend with another color in a small area, to add some sparkle or pop. This works really well threaded as a second thread in my embroidery machine. have to slow the stitches per minute, but it rarely breaks or tangles. Again, it's for small areas, it's not great for large ones. Even the best machines don't want to run double threads for very long. But this thread works very well.

Provides nice accenting to projects – Locking top to keep thread from unspooling
I already had one spool of this thread on hand that I purchased awhile back locally. I wanted another to ensure I didn't run out on my quilt and this thread is a little difficult to find in stores. I was super happy to see it here on Amazon and the product I received is identical to the one I already had. This thread is super pretty and gives a nice metallic accent to your projects. The thread looks good on a number of different colours and takes on a different colour depending on your fabric. Being a metallic thread you will want to ensure you adjust your tension and may wish to use a top-stitch needle that has a bigger eye and groove to help with the friction on the thread. I also really like the fact that you can press the top of the spool upwards with your thumb and it will extend creating a groove to trap your thread end into before securing it back in place. I've tried to show this in the picture if you haven't noticed this feature before. The pictures really don't do this thread justice as it's hard to see the highlighting but it turns out very nice.
